Ethereum founder Vitalik Buterin has unveiled the blockchain platform’s new direction, highlighting how its priorities changed since 2023. The latest Strawmap focuses on privacy, quantum safety, scalability, and security. As the blockchain prepares for post-quantum security measures, it puts greater focus on privacy and protection. According to Buterin, many of the ideas presented in the earlier roadmap have been reshuffled, replaced, or deprioritized.
